This is a follow up CL to my previous CL [1], which enabled us to test
Direct-Reply with EditTextVariations.
What this CL does are:
* Specyfing min_sdk_version to avoid INSTALL_FAILED_OLDER_SDK error
when installing on older devices.
* Avoiding NoSuchMethodError on pre-O devices where
Notification.Builder does not have a constructor that takes
notification channel.
* Fixing a race condition where notification can be sent before
notification channel is created.

With this CL, EditTextVariations is able to send Direct Repply
notification so that we can easily test IME behaviors there.
You don't need to set up a chat application then let it receive a
message from someone else any more just to test IME behaviors on
Direct Reply.

This will allow to greatly improve the performance of the
metadata-generating files, as they won't have to wait for
the info command to read the entire dictionary when the
header is all we need.
Also add tests, and while we're at it, use the seed as
intended to enable reproducible tests.

It's still unused as of this change but the next change will use it
As a reference point, generating the metadata for Bayo takes
3'02" on my machine with the info command; it's down to 16" if
made to use this instead. The gains increases with the number
of dictionaries obviously.
